Handling Specialty, an Ontario-based manufacturer demonstrates the improvements ETO organizations experience when working with the right ERP. Within the first five years of using Total ETO, they doubled their sales. Handling Specialty also reduced their design and shop hours by 10.3%. This led to a six-fold increase in profits. This case study focuses on their gains. First, however, it describes some of the problems they faced. As a Custom Machine Builder, you’ll probably be able to relate to some, such as:

  • Customers often request changes to the order during the design process, sometimes even after. This impacts design time and purchasing efforts.
  • Engineering often needs to pre-release components to procurement in order to meet deliveries. This requires special effort to manage the bill of materials interaction with purchasing.
  • The team often identifies areas where the design needs to be changed. This requires engineering to modify the drawings and the BOM. Furthermore, procurement then needs to change material orders.

2. How does Total ETO manage my bill of materials?

By making your BOMs Dynamic! Total ETO provides a separate engineering screen to manage entire Projects and individual Jobs. A bill of materials (BOM) can be built in a hierarchy, rather than a flat BOM, and is displayed in a flexible graphical user interface. By displaying the BOM visually, designers have greater flexibility to break down assemblies and more easily manage changes to an assembly quantity or parts within the assembly.

3. Once I’ve released parts from my bill of materials, can I still make changes or is the BOM now static?

Engineer To Order companies know their BOM needs to be fluid. With this ERP designed for engineers, your BOM is never locked down. Total ETO allows engineers to change and release their BOM as needed, even items they’ve previously released. This includes changes to previously released parts, assemblies and even the entire BOM. Total ETO will communicate any material changes to procurement for you.

4. Does Total ETO integrate with my CAD system?

Yes, of course we do! Since we’re partners with Dassault and Autodesk, Total ETO provides integrated 3D CAD linking within SOLIDWORKS and Inventor, embedding our controls in their CAD systems, allowing designers to easily push BOM information to Total ETO.

For other CAD systems, our BOM Import tool can quickly import a BOM file exported from applications such as SOLIDWORKS Electrical, E-Plan, and Solid Edge, among many others, eliminating double entry, and possible data entry mistakes.

5. Can I track Non-Conformances in Total ETO?

Total ETO’s Non-Conformance (NC) system allows users to raise NCs from several different areas within the system and allows users to track various causes of the issue such as defective parts, drawing or design errors, and manufacturing errors. Non-conformances are attached to Jobs and can have both labor and material costs associated to them. Coupled with powerful searches and powerful reporting, our Engineer To Order software solution provides the ability to identify the causes of non-conformances and allows users to prevent them from occurring on similar future projects.
